The PetSol Anti Barking Dog Collar is a humane training device designed to deter excessive barking through sound and vibration, featuring 8 progressive levels of stimulation. Made from high-quality reflective nylon, it ensures safety during nighttime walks. The collar is adjustable for different dog sizes and sensitivities, and comes with a 60-day satisfaction guarantee.

This actually works!
I have 2 small dogs who both really really like to bark...alot. My Chihuahua is the worst of the 2 and could bark all day if allowed! I bought one of these collars to try and it works! I don't need one for my other dog as she hates the beeping warning noise so that in itself is a good deterrent.I would recommend this collar to anyone with a noisy yappy dog - it works and it does not hurt them at all. It gives a short beep when they first bark as a warning then if they continue it will give off a longer beep, if they still carry on it will give off a long beep followed by a vibration from the two small plastic nodules. Usually the first beep is enough to stop her.Great product.
